What is ATS and How Does It Work?
An Applicant Tracking System (ATS) is software that scans your resume, extracts information (name, skills, experience, education), and scores it against the job description. Resumes below a threshold score are automatically rejected — the recruiter never sees them.
- •Infosys uses Workday-based ATS for their career portal
- •Wipro uses a custom ATS integrated with their iRise platform
- •HCL uses SAP SuccessFactors for recruitment
- •Tech Mahindra uses Taleo (now Oracle Recruiting Cloud)
- •All of them parse resumes for keywords, formatting, and relevance
7 Rules to Pass ATS at Indian IT Companies
Rule 1: Mirror the Job Description
ATS scores your resume based on keyword match with the job description. If the JD says "Spring Boot" and you wrote "SpringBoot" (no space), the ATS might miss it. Copy exact phrases from the job description into your resume.
Rule 2: Use Standard Section Headings
- •Use "Work Experience" — not "My Journey" or "Career Path"
- •Use "Education" — not "Academic Background" or "Qualification"
- •Use "Technical Skills" — not "Tech Arsenal" or "My Stack"
- •Use "Certifications" — not "Learning Badges" or "Credentials"
- •ATS looks for standard headings; creative names cause parsing failures
Rule 3: No Headers, Footers, or Text Boxes
Most ATS systems cannot read content in headers, footers, or text boxes. If your name and contact info is in the header, the ATS won't extract it. Put everything in the main body of the document.
Rule 4: Use Simple Formatting
- •Fonts: Arial, Calibri, Times New Roman, or Helvetica only
- •No images, logos, icons, or graphics anywhere
- •No tables for layout (ATS reads tables cell-by-cell, jumbling your info)
- •Standard bullet points (•) — not arrows, diamonds, or custom symbols
- •PDF format is safe. .docx also works. Never use .pages or .odt

Check Your ATS Score Free →Rule 5: Include Both Spelled-Out and Abbreviated Terms
Write "Amazon Web Services (AWS)" instead of just "AWS". Write "Machine Learning (ML)". The ATS might search for either form. Including both guarantees a match.
Rule 6: Quantify Your Achievements
ATS passes resumes to recruiters who skim them in 6 seconds. Numbers catch attention:
- •"Reduced API response time by 35% using Redis caching"
- •"Led a team of 5 developers for a ₹2 crore client project"
- •"Automated 15 manual test cases, saving 8 hours/week"
- •"Handled 500+ daily support tickets with 98% resolution rate"
Rule 7: Customize for Each Application
Don't send the same resume to Infosys and Wipro. Each job description has different keywords. Spend 10 minutes customizing your resume for each application. This single habit can increase your callback rate by 3x.
Top ATS Keywords for Indian IT Companies (2026)
- •Infosys: Java, Spring Boot, Microservices, Cloud, Agile, SAP, Salesforce, Infosys Springboard certifications
- •Wipro: Full Stack, Angular, React, .NET, DevOps, Wipro Turbo/Elite certifications
- •HCL: Java, ServiceNow, SAP HANA, Cloud Infrastructure, Cybersecurity
- •Tech Mahindra: 5G, Telecom, AI/ML, Salesforce, Digital Transformation
